|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ard cutting tools not designed for dense plastics. | Employ sharp, high-quality carbide-tipped blades specifically designed for cutting nylon or similar polymers to ensure clean, precise cuts and prevent melting or chipping. |
| Overheating the material during machining processes. | Utilize appropriate cooling methods, such as air jets or coolant, during machining to prevent thermal degradation of the nylon, which can compromise its mechanical properties. |
